The Charge Registered Nurse is a professional nurse who coordinates, supports and supervises other Registered Nurses in the delivery of nursing care. They ensure the nursing unit runs smoothly and efficiently and oversees the transition between shifts. The Charge Registered Nurse participates in patient and family teaching, provides leadership by working cooperatively with leadership, ancillary staff and other members of the patient care team in maintaining standards of professional nursing practice in the clinical setting.
The Charge Registered Nurse serves as a liaison between physicians, nurses and staff.
- Institutes and initiates a plan of care for patient based on the initial assessment within the shift, documents; implements and continuously evaluates interventions; reassesses patient needs on an ongoing basis as required per unit or procedure
- Develops, discusses and communicates a realistic problem list (plan of care) for each patient, in collaboration with each patient/family/significant other to address identified needs
- Recognizes changing patient condition and modifies plan by using resources, chain of command and Rapid Response Team (RRT) promptly and appropriately
- Assimilates and prioritizes information sources to take immediate and decisive patient-focused action by routinely performing patient rounds and addressing concerns timely
- Maintains a safe environment and responds with confidence and adapts to rapid changing patient conditions and emergent situations
- Demonstrates the skills and judgement necessary to implement plan of care, nursing interventions and procedures necessary for the care of the patient
- Appropriately documents all assessments, plans of care specific to patient and identified problem for care provided accurately
